Town Of South Kingstown: Saugatucket Park Improvements

Effective February 5, 2024, the Parks and Recreation Department is overseeing planned infrastructure improvements at Saugatucket Park on High Street. The selected contractor has erected temporary fencing as well as required soil and erosion control measures that will be in place until the project is completed. The park walking path will be replaced with a new asphalt path that reflects the original park master plan designed by the Olmsted Brothers Landscape Architects. Additionally, the chain-link fence running between the park and Saugatucket River will be removed, and invasive species growth will be addressed. A long-term mitigation plan to manage invasives will continue as an element of the project plan.

The public's patience is appreciated while this work is under way. This project is partially funded through a RIDEM Recreation Development Grant.
